Seasalt is having a moment. With 56 per cent of sales coming from digital channels and a healthy future in international and domestic markets, the brand has become one of the biggest success stories of British retail in recent years – and sales are expected to hit £100m by the end of January 2022. Not bad for a business that started life selling workwear to local farmers and fishermen.

In this episode of the Industry Leaders Podcast, Sorcha O’Boyle caught up with Seasalt CEO Paul Hayes to learn more about how he positioned the brand for growth, why they avoid discounting and what lies in store for Seasalt in the future.
